Per a social media report, a supercharging site has been spotted under construction in a parking lot at: Target 3660 Marketplace Blvd East Point, GA 30344 For locals, this is at the intersection of I-285 and Camp Creek Parkway, west of the airport. Stopped by the East Point Target SC installation site today. As you can see by the pics, most of the piping seems to be done, forms are set, and now waiting for concrete, and of course better weather! It looks like 10 or 11 pedestal conduits poking up, and although 1 or 2 may be for lighting. So this could be an 8 or a 10-pedestal site, or more, if additional pedestals are installed to the right of the Transformer & Control area..
Conduit is in, concrete poured, V3 cabinets onsite. This looks like it will be TWELVE pedestals, with 10 accessed from both sides of a concrete aisle, and then two more near the cabinets. Conduit at cabinet pad and three cabinets supports this. We'll see for sure in about a week I guess.
